Excel如何自动生成比赛顺序号?如何快速排序?
作者:佚名|分类:EXCEL|浏览:142|发布时间:2025-04-02 16:01:45
Excel如何自动生成比赛顺序号?如何快速排序?
在组织比赛或任何需要编号排序的活动时,Excel是一个强大的工具,可以帮助我们高效地管理数据。以下将详细介绍如何在Excel中自动生成比赛顺序号以及如何快速对生成的顺序号进行排序。
一、自动生成比赛顺序号
1. 准备工作
打开Excel,创建一个新的工作表。
在第一列(例如A列)输入参赛者的名字或其他标识信息。
2. 插入顺序号
在A列的顶部(第一行)输入“顺序号”作为标题。
在A2单元格中输入公式:`=ROW(A1)+1`。
将A2单元格中的公式向下拖动或双击填充柄,直到所有参赛者的顺序号都被生成。
3. 解释公式
`ROW(A1)` 返回A1单元格的行号。
`+1` 是因为顺序号通常从1开始,而不是从0开始。
二、如何快速排序
1. 选择数据区域
选中包含顺序号和参赛者信息的列(例如A列和B列)。
2. 使用排序功能
点击“数据”选项卡。
在“排序和筛选”组中,点击“排序”。
在弹出的“排序”对话框中,选择“顺序号”列作为主要关键字。
选择排序方式(升序或降序)。
点击“确定”按钮。
3. 排序结果
Excel会根据顺序号列的值对数据进行排序。
三、注意事项
公式复制:在生成顺序号时,确保公式正确复制到所有参赛者。
数据验证:在输入参赛者信息时,可以使用数据验证功能确保输入的数据格式正确。
隐藏列:如果不需要显示顺序号列,可以将其隐藏,以保持工作表整洁。
四、相关问答
1. 问答:为什么我的顺序号不是从1开始?
回答:这是因为你在A2单元格中输入的公式是`=ROW(A1)+1`。如果A1单元格是标题,那么ROW(A1)返回的是0,所以顺序号从2开始。你可以将A1单元格的内容删除或修改为参赛者的名字,然后重新应用公式。
2. 问答:如何对多个列进行排序?
回答:在“排序”对话框中,你可以添加多个关键字。首先选择主要关键字,然后点击“添加条件”来添加次要关键字。你可以为每个关键字选择不同的排序方式。
3. 问答:排序后,如何恢复原始顺序?
回答:在排序后,你可以通过点击“数据”选项卡中的“排序和筛选”组中的“取消排序”来恢复原始顺序。
4. 问答:如何批量生成顺序号?
回答:如果你有大量的参赛者信息,可以使用宏或VBA脚本来批量生成顺序号。这需要一定的Excel VBA编程知识。
通过以上步骤,你可以在Excel中轻松地自动生成比赛顺序号,并对数据进行快速排序。Excel的强大功能可以帮助你更高效地管理比赛数据。